Mar 15, 2023 · IoT Hub was developed to address the unique requirements of connecting IoT devices to the Azure cloud while Event Hubs was designed for big data streaming. Microsoft recommends using Azure IoT Hub to connect IoT devices to Azure. Azure IoT Hub is the cloud gateway that connects IoT devices to gather data and drive business insights and ...

Jan 12, 2020 · Event Hub: Limited protocol support — HTTPS, AMQP, AMQP IoT Hub: Has additional — MQTT. Difference #3: Number of connections. Event Hub: Supports only up to 5000 connections simultaneously IoT Hub: Supports > 5000 connections (Up to millions) Difference #4: Security. Event Hub: Event Hub — wide identity using Shared Access Token (SAS)
